Inadequate Flashing Installment
Choosing the appropriate products isn't the only aspect that can cause roof issues; inadequate blinking installation can likewise develop substantial issues. Flashing is critical for directing water far from at risk locations, such as smokeshafts, skylights, and roof valleys. If it's not installed correctly, you risk water breach, which can result in mold and mildew development and architectural damage.
When you install flashing, guarantee it's the best kind for your roof covering's layout and the neighborhood climate. For example, metal flashing is usually much more long lasting than plastic in locations with heavy rainfall or snow. See to it the blinking overlaps appropriately and is safeguarded securely to stop spaces where water can permeate through.
You should additionally take notice of the installation angle. Blinking should be placed to direct water far from your home, not towards it.
If you're unclear about the installment procedure or the products needed, seek advice from an expert. They can assist determine the very best flashing alternatives and ensure whatever is installed correctly, protecting your home from prospective water damage.

Neglecting Air Flow Needs
While lots of home owners focus on the visual and architectural elements of roof covering installation, disregarding ventilation demands can cause severe long-term repercussions. Correct ventilation is vital for controling temperature and wetness degrees in your attic room, preventing problems like mold and mildew growth, timber rot, and ice dams. If you do not set up sufficient air flow, you're establishing your roof covering up for failing.

Ensure you have actually set up soffit vents along the eaves and ridge vents at the optimal of your roof covering. This combination enables hot air to leave while cooler air enters, keeping your attic room area comfortable.
Additionally, take into consideration the kind of roof covering material you have actually picked. Some products might call for added air flow techniques. Verify your neighborhood building ordinance for ventilation guidelines, as they can differ dramatically.
Lastly, don't fail to remember to check your air flow system routinely. Clogs from particles or insulation can hinder air flow, so keep those vents clear.
